Unhyphenated Identities
The Social Psychology of Belonging, Rejection, and the Decline of Dual Identity in Diasporas

Beschreibung
Across Europe, postmigrants face pressure from two directions at once: host societies that question their loyalty, and homelands that seek to reclaim it. The result is a steady erosion of dual or hyphenated identity - the capacity to feel genuinely at home in two cultures. Drawing on interviews, large-scale surveys, and newly collected data, Aydın Bayad traces that erosion among Turkish and Post-Soviet communities in Germany. He introduces a new framework for understanding how people interpret rejection to uncover the psychological and political forces that reshape belonging over time. Timely, interdisciplinary, and grounded in lived experience, this volume offers a new perspective on identity, migration, and cohesion in a polarised Europe.
